Cornuda Social Support Project Launches with Community and Institutional Collaboration
Cornuda Convention
Start of the agreement and participants
On early June 1996, an agreement was held at the Casa Sociale hall in Cornuda for signing a project aimed at supporting the most vulnerable social groups. Some representatives of local political and social forces participated in the operation, including the mayor, representatives of the neighborhood association, and various volunteer organizations.
Objectives and funding
The project, which will last two years, particularly aims to improve the living conditions of the elderly and disabled residents in the municipality. The total amount allocated for the implementation of the initiative is approximately one hundred thousand euros, financed with regional and community funds.
Planned activities and specific goals
The activities include home assistance services, psychological support, training and socialization courses for the weaker groups. Social transport will also be enhanced, and listening and gathering centers established.
Purpose and social inclusion
The project aims to promote social inclusion and improve the quality of life for the involved individuals, also creating opportunities for community gathering and solidarity.
Role of institutions and associations
The municipal administration has committed to supporting the initiatives by ensuring surveillance services and coordination among the various involved components.
Volunteer organizations will play a central role in organizing and managing activities, guaranteeing active participation from the local community.
